Web5 jun. 2013 · - Pre and post development runoff calculations for runoff for 2 and 25 yr storms. - Design stormwater management facilities zero net increase in runoff rate for … Web11 dec. 2024 · The Rational equation is q = CiA, where q is the peak surface runoff rate in cfs, C is the runoff coefficient, i is the design rainfall intensity in in/hr, and A is the area of the watershed in acres. The time of concentration, design storm return period, and an IDF relationship for the region are needed to find the design rainfall intensity.
